Summary:
The four initial essays in the 'Specific Writers and Works' section display Pizer's critical style in its characteristic varied and incisive form. The initial essay, an exercise in cross-discipline analysis, discusses the ways specific works by Crane, Dreiser, and Steinbeck reveal their author's response to specific contemporary visual art works and reportage. The seconds offers a novel way of interpreting the naturalism of London' archetypal story 'To Light a Fire' by pointing out the weaknesses in Lee Clark Mitchell's reading. The third centers on the usefulness of Norman Mailer's essay on American Naturalism not only in its refutation of Lionel Trilling's attack on the movement but in sharing with Trilling and others a misunderstanding of the central thrust of Theodore Dreiser's work. And the fourth is a close reading of Dos Passos over the course of three works of his experience of the 1931 Harland Coal Strike to clarify his thinking of the best means for the artist both to represent and participate in the struggle for social justice in America.
